Please post your comments and suggestions for this article.

Comment by frans klaus on June 11th, 2010 at 2:08 am

The article states: “The four largest cities of the Netherlands—Amsterdam, Rotterdam, The Hague, and Utrecht—are in Holland”. As native of this country (born in Holland) I happen to know that the city of Utrecht is located in the province of the same name, and not in Holland.

Leave a Reply

return to top